What is the WIC Program?

The San Saba WIC program is an initiative developed by the United States government, the food and nutrition service agency department. It sights to promote the health of infants, women, and children by providing food, healthcare, nutrition, and education to low-earning families in San Saba, Texas. However, involved families need to meet state residency and income guidelines to be eligible for WIC services. For instance, they must fall below 185 percent of the United States poverty income rule based on income. The main priorities are pregnant, non-breastfeeding post-partum women and children up to the age of 5 with nutritional risk. San Saba Clinic WIC Office works through hospitals, mobile clinics, schools, county health departments, community centers, and migrant health camps.
